WEAR INVESTIGATIONS OF SELECTED ELEMENTS OF MEDIUM SPEED DIESEL ENGINES FEEDED WITH RESIDUAL FUELS

Journal Title: Tribologia - Year 2014, Vol 254, Issue 2

Abstract

The paper presents the results of the selected object, the elements and of tribological systems in the aspect of wear processes. The objects of research were medium speed engines produced under license from Sulzer. Among the tested objects were the types of engines powered by residual fuels subject to intensive wear. These fuels contain significant amounts of sulphur and water and have a large number of Conradson carbon residue. The wear investigations were performed under natural conditions. The paper also describes the conditions under which the test engines operate, which are often unfavourable tropical conditions. A significant wear of crank pins, cylinder liners, pistons, and cylinder heads were indicated. Intensive wear results from engine design, in which the lubrication system of pistons and sleeves and bearings of the crankshaft is the same. The wear investigations were carried out by applying passive observation, geometrical measurements, and analysis of images, and with applying passive and passive-active diagnostic experiments. The inspected engines showed intensive wear of metal materials and the formation of deposits. An identification of types of the wear was also a purpose of the research.
